Miette River (AB) - Upper II
Fairly continuous grade 2 rapids through some beautiful forest. Everything is read and run but watch for log jams. One shot waves abound.
At some flows good eddy service feeds a surf wave just above the bridge, eddy river left.
Past the Meadow Creek confluence take the narrow left channel for some more technical paddling, there are few eddys in this channel though so watch for wood. Go right for a less technical line.

Run Information
Takeout
From Jasper drive ~11Km west on Hwy 16 and park at the pull out on the North side of the road. This is the takout.
Put In
From the takeout drive ~4Km east to the rock cut on the south side of the road. Near the top of the hill as the road prepares to turn left there is an abandoned service road and a gravel pull out on the North side of the road. Park here. Hike down the hill and across the train tracks to the river.
Character
continuous run with a couple of play spots at higher flows. May be wood choked.
Length & Time
10km, Couple_Hours

Flow Information
Flows peak in the early summer due to snow melt. There is no gauge for the river, assess flow at the take-out.
